OOU Postgraduate Programmes Duration

  1.  Postgraduate Diploma Programmes:
    Minimum Duration           Maximum Duration
    Full-Time    –    2 Semesters          4 Semesters
    Part-Time   –    3 Semesters          6 Semesters
  2.  Professional Master Degree Programme:
    Minimum Duration           Maximum Duration
    Full-Time    –    3 Semesters          6 Semesters
    Part-Time   –    4 Semesters          8 Semesters

     3.   Academic Master Degree Progammes:
Minimum Duration           Maximum Duration
Full-Time   –    3 semesters           6 Semesters
Part-Time   –    4 Semesters          8 Semesters

     4. Ph.D. Programmes:

Minimum Duration           Maximum Duration

Full-Time    –    6 Semesters          10 Semesters

Part-Time   –    8 Semesters          12 Semesters

 

OOU Postgraduate Programmes Admission Requirements

  1.  Postgraduate Diploma Programmes
    Applicants for admission into the Postgraduate Diploma Programme must be:
  1. Graduate of the Olabisi Onabanjo University or any other approved University with a minimum of Third Class.
  2. Holders of Higher National Diploma at not less than Lower Credit level.
  1.  Academic Master Degree Programmes
    (i)   M.A/M.Sc./M.Ed., LL.M
    Applicants shall normally possess not lower than Second Class Honours (Lower Division) Degree of the Olabisi Onabanjo University or any other approved University in relevant disciplines.
  2.  Professional Master Degree Programmes
    Applicants shall normally possess not lower than Second Class Honours (Lower Division) Degree of the Olabisi Onabanjo University or other approved University or a Higher National Diploma at not less than Lower Credit level  or a Third Class University Degree with a Postgraduate Diploma in relevant field(s) and/or fellowship of relevant professional body.
  3.  Ph.D Programmes
  1. Candidates who obtained their Master degree in relevant disciplines from Olabisi Onabanjo University with a minimum of 3.50 Cumulative Grade Points would be allowed to register for Ph.D. programmes directly.
  2. Candidates from Olabisi Onabanjo University with Cumulative Grade Points of 3.00 to 3.49 will only be admitted for M.Phil/Ph.D. and not Ph.D. directly. Their candidature for Ph.D. shall however be determined on the basis of their performance after two (2) Semesters course work.
  3. Candidates who obtained their Master degree in relevant disciplines from other Institutions apart from Olabisi Onabanjo University with a minimum of 3.00 Cumulative Grade Points on a 5 point Scale or Weighted Average of 50% will only be admitted for M.Phil/Ph.D. Their candidature for Ph.D. shall however be determined on the basis of their performance after two (2) Semesters course work.
  1.  Candidates applying for the following programmes are to note their admission requirements:
  2. M.Sc. and Ph.D. In Mass Communication
    • O’Level Credit pass in English Language and Mathematics are compulsory for all applicants for Mass Communication Programmes
  1. Postgraduate Diploma in Law
  • o Candidates having not less than Third Class Bachelor’s Degree in Law of the Olabisi Onabanjo University or any other approved University.
  • o Candidates must possess at least five credit passes at O’Level including English Language and English Literature.
  1. Master of Laws (LL.M)
  • o Five (5) O’ Level Credit including English Language, English Literature and Mathematics.
  • o Holders of Bachelor of Law (LL.B) Degree of Olabisi Onabanjo University or any other University recognized by the Senate of Olabisi Onabanjo  University with a minimum of Second Class Lower; and
  • o Holders of Bachelor of Law (LL.B) Degree of Olabisi Onabanjo University or any other University recognized by the Senate of Olabisi Onabanjo University who do not meet the requirement in (a) above but hold the Postgraduate Diploma in Law Degree.
  1. Ph.D. Law
  • o Five O’ Level Credit including English Language, English Literature.
  • o Bachelor of Laws (LL.B) degree of this University or any other recognized University with at least Second Class Lower Division.
  • o Candidates with Master of Laws (LL.M) of this University with at least 3.50 Cumulative Grade Point Average (CGPA) will be admitted into Direct Ph.D. Programmes
  • o Candidates with Master of Law (LL.M) of this University or from recognized University with at least 3.00 cumulative Grade Point Average (CGPA) on a 5 – Point Scale or Weighted Average of 50% will be admitted through M.Phil./Ph.D.
  • o Candidates with Master of Laws (LL.M) of other Universities with at least 3.00 Cumulative Grade Point Average (CGPA) with be admitted through M.Phil./Ph.D.
  1. Postgraduate Diploma in Anaesthesia
    •  Holders of a good First Degree in Medicine and Surgery from Olabisi Onabanjo University or any other University approved by Senate of Olabisi Onabanjo University.
  2. Master of Public Health (MPH)
    • Graduates of Olabisi Onabanjo University with a degree of M.B.Ch.B or equivalent Medical and Dental Degrees such as MBS/BDS from other recognized Universities. Candidates must possess at least five years qualification experience (including Internship, NYSC Services plus three years working experience in areas relevant to Public Health.
  3. Postgraduate Diploma in Pharmaceutical Analysis
    • Holders of honours degrees in a relevant Science discipline (e.g., Pharmacy, Chemistry, Analytical Chemistry, Industrial Chemistry, Microbiology, Biochemistry, Pharmacology, Veterinary Medicine and other allied courses).  Class of degree need to be specified.
  4. M.Sc. Pharmaceutical and Medicinal Chemistry
  • o Graduates of this University or any other approved University holding a degree equivalent to at least Second Class (Lower Division) or GPA of not less than 3.00 in any of the following disciplines: Pharmacy, Chemistry, Biochemistry or Botany.  Candidates may however be required to satisfy a selection process
  1. M.Sc. Pharmaceutics and Pharmaceutical Technology
  • o Holders of a good First Degree in Pharmacy (unclassified) from Olabisi Onabanjo University or any other University approved by Senate of Olabisi Onabanjo University.
  • o Holders of a classified Pharmacy degree not below Second Class Honours (Lower Division) or CGPA of not less than 3.00 may be admitted.
  • o Candidates must have scored acceptable grades (not less than C) in Pharmaceutics courses in their final year undergraduate examinations.
  1. Ph.D. Pharmaceutical and Medicinal Chemistry
  • o Holder  of a Master of Sciences Degree (M.Sc.) in Pharmaceutical Chemistry/Medicinal Chemistry from this University or an equivalent qualification from any other approved University with a B+ (60) average.
  • o Holders of a Master of Science Degree (M.Sc.) in Chemistry, Biochemistry from this University or any other approved University, with a B+ (60) average.
  • o Holders of a degree of Master of Philosophy (M.Phil.) or equivalent in Pharmaceutical Chemistry from this University or any other approved University.

IN ADDITION TO THE STATED ADMISSION REQUIREMENTS FOR INDIVIDUAL PROGRAMMES ABOVE, ALL APPLICANTS ARE TO NOTE THAT: 

  1. All programmes in the University require O’ Level Credit pass in English Language and Mathematics in addition to three other credits in relevant subjects.
  2. The University Matriculation requirements of individual Departments running the programme must be satisfied before a candidate can be considered for admission.
  3. For admission into any of the Programmes, possession of National Youth Service Corps (N.Y.S.C.) Discharge/Exemption/Exclusion Certificate issued by the Directorate is compulsory (if a Nigerian).
  4. All Applicants are to request their Institutions to forward the Academic Transcripts of their Higher National Diploma / 1st Degree / Postgraduate Diploma / Master Degree to the Secretary, Postgraduate School, Olabisi Onabanjo University, Ago-Iwoye not later than Friday, 30th June, 2017.
  5. All Ph.D. candidates are required to contact the relevant Departments for availability of Supervisors and vacancies before applying.
  6. Every applicant is required to submit photocopies of all certificates listed in the application form such as Degree, Diploma, NYSC and Professional Certificates at the relevant Departments.
  7. Completed Application Form and Acknowledgement Slip/Photo card are to be submitted to the Secretary, Postgraduate School and to the relevant Department not later than Friday, 30th June, 2017.
